研究领域

一直以来致力于柔性电子器件的研制及其产业化研究,包括柔性太阳能电池,纳米发电机,柔性电致变色器件以及柔性生物相容,可降解传感器。近5年来,在JACs, Advanced Materials, Nano Letters, ACS Nano等国际著名期刊发表论文50余篇,其中影响因子IF>10论文超过20ESI高引文章4,论文他引次数超过2500次,H因子(h-index)为26。相关工作被英国物理学会评为“2012年物理世界的十大突破之一”。首创ITO-free柔性方形裂纹透明导电膜,极力推动柔性透明导电膜以及柔性器件的产业化发展。获得互联网+,“创青春”等创业大赛四项全国金奖
